Which one of the following is NOT the main aim of Human Genome Project ?
Options
- AMapping the entire human genome at the level of nucleotide sequences.
- BTo store the information collected from the project in databases.
- CTo prevent the transfer of related technologies to the private sectors, such as industries.
- DTo develop tools and techniques for analysis of data.
Correct answer
C. To prevent the transfer of related technologies to the private sectors, such as industries.
Step-by-step solution
The main goals of the Human Genome Project (HGP) include mapping the entire human genome at the level of nucleotide sequences, storing the information in databases, improving tools for data analysis, and addressing ethical, legal, and social issues (ELSI). Another important goal of the HGP is to transfer related technologies to other sectors, such as private industries, to stimulate medical and biological research and development.
